Transaction a509264710faa0fa9345be47a64cdc38fa362160f39b974066e15d8c9dcc49e0
1 Input
1 Output
-
a509264710faa0fa9345be47a64cdc38fa362160f39b974066e15d8c9dcc49e0:0
- value
- 43077237
- script pubkey
- OP_0 OP_PUSHBYTES_20 8168654c1d126b45a8bbf1bc1fa69f55873acead
- address
- bc1qs95x2nqazf45t29m7x7plf5l2krn4n4d88x8sj